VORONEZH, June 25. /TASS/. The death toll from the Ukrainian attack on Voronezh on June 22 has risen to six, with 62 people injured, Governor Alexander Gusev reporterd.
"The total number of casualties currently stands at 68, six of whom have died. To our great sorrow, the last missing person was found lifeless under the rubble," the regional head wrote in a post on his Max channel.
On June 22, the destruction of high-speed aerial targets in Voronezh damaged production facilities at one of the enterprises, several apartment buildings, and vehicles.
